2017 AOA to STD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2017

During 2017, the AOA to STD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 3, valuing the pair at 141.3496.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on September 10, dropping to 122.8069.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 18.5427 STD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 139.0995 to the December average rate of 124.6689, the exchange rate registered a net change of -10.37%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2017 high of 141.3496 was down 15.78% compared to the 2016 peak of 167.8267,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
